The Navigation interface is used for creating and injecting navigation related events such as mouse button presses, cursor motion and key presses. The associated library also provides methods for parsing received events, and for sending and receiving navigation related bus events. One main usecase is DVD menu navigation.
The main parts of the API are:
- The GstNavigation interface, implemented by elements which provide an application with the ability to create and inject navigation events into the pipeline.
- GstNavigation event handling API. GstNavigation events are created in response to calls on a GstNavigation interface implementation, and sent in the pipeline. Upstream elements can use the navigation event API functions to parse the contents of received messages.
- GstNavigation message handling API. GstNavigation messages may be sent on the message bus to inform applications of navigation related changes in the pipeline, such as the mouse moving over a clickable region, or the set of available angles changing.
The GstNavigation message functions provide functions for creating and parsing custom bus messages for signaling GstNavigation changes.
Synopsis
- newtype Navigation = Navigation (ManagedPtr Navigation)
- class (ManagedPtrNewtype o, IsDescendantOf Navigation o) => IsNavigation o
- navigationEventGetType :: (HasCallStack, MonadIO m) => Event -> m NavigationEventType
- navigationEventParseCommand :: (HasCallStack, MonadIO m) => Event -> m (Bool, NavigationCommand)
- navigationEventParseKeyEvent :: (HasCallStack, MonadIO m) => Event -> m (Bool, Text)
- navigationEventParseMouseButtonEvent :: (HasCallStack, MonadIO m) => Event -> m (Bool, Int32, Double, Double)
- navigationEventParseMouseMoveEvent :: (HasCallStack, MonadIO m) => Event -> m (Bool, Double, Double)
- navigationMessageGetType :: (HasCallStack, MonadIO m) => Message -> m NavigationMessageType
- navigationMessageNewAnglesChanged :: (HasCallStack, MonadIO m, IsObject a) => a -> Word32 -> Word32 -> m Message
- navigationMessageNewCommandsChanged :: (HasCallStack, MonadIO m, IsObject a) => a -> m Message
- navigationMessageNewEvent :: (HasCallStack, MonadIO m, IsObject a) => a -> Event -> m Message
- navigationMessageNewMouseOver :: (HasCallStack, MonadIO m, IsObject a) => a -> Bool -> m Message
- navigationMessageParseAnglesChanged :: (HasCallStack, MonadIO m) => Message -> m (Bool, Word32, Word32)
- navigationMessageParseEvent :: (HasCallStack, MonadIO m) => Message -> m (Bool, Event)
- navigationMessageParseMouseOver :: (HasCallStack, MonadIO m) => Message -> m (Bool, Bool)
- navigationQueryGetType :: (HasCallStack, MonadIO m) => Query -> m NavigationQueryType
- navigationQueryNewAngles :: (HasCallStack, MonadIO m) => m Query
- navigationQueryNewCommands :: (HasCallStack, MonadIO m) => m Query
- navigationQueryParseAngles :: (HasCallStack, MonadIO m) => Query -> m (Bool, Word32, Word32)
- navigationQueryParseCommandsLength :: (HasCallStack, MonadIO m) => Query -> m (Bool, Word32)
- navigationQueryParseCommandsNth :: (HasCallStack, MonadIO m) => Query -> Word32 -> m (Bool, NavigationCommand)
- navigationQuerySetAngles :: (HasCallStack, MonadIO m) => Query -> Word32 -> Word32 -> m ()
- navigationQuerySetCommandsv :: (HasCallStack, MonadIO m) => Query -> [NavigationCommand] -> m ()
- navigationSendCommand :: (HasCallStack, MonadIO m, IsNavigation a) => a -> NavigationCommand -> m ()
- navigationSendEvent :: (HasCallStack, MonadIO m, IsNavigation a) => a -> Structure -> m ()
- navigationSendKeyEvent :: (HasCallStack, MonadIO m, IsNavigation a) => a -> Text -> Text -> m ()
- navigationSendMouseEvent :: (HasCallStack, MonadIO m, IsNavigation a) => a -> Text -> Int32 -> Double -> Double -> m ()

messageParseMouseOver
navigationMessageParseMouseOver Source #
:: (HasCallStack, MonadIO m) | |
=> Message |
|
-> m (Bool, Bool) | Returns: |
Parse a Navigation
message of type GST_NAVIGATION_MESSAGE_MOUSE_OVER
and extract the active/inactive flag. If the mouse over event is marked
active, it indicates that the mouse is over a clickable area.

queryNewAngles
navigationQueryNewAngles Source #
:: (HasCallStack, MonadIO m) | |
=> m Query | Returns: The new query. |
Create a new Navigation
angles query. When executed, it will
query the pipeline for the set of currently available angles, which may be
greater than one in a multiangle video.

sendMouseEvent
navigationSendMouseEvent Source #
:: (HasCallStack, MonadIO m, IsNavigation a) | |
=> a |
|
-> Text |
|
-> Int32 |
|
-> Double |
|
-> Double |
|
-> m () |
Sends a mouse event to the navigation interface. Mouse event coordinates
are sent relative to the display space of the related output area. This is
usually the size in pixels of the window associated with the element
implementing the Navigation
interface.
